What are Excavation Services? 

Excavation is the process of removing unwanted and complicated structures from the construction area. These structures may be rocks, boulders, tiny fragments, dust, or unnecessary material.  

The goal of excavation is to clean the construction area and protect it from hazardous chemicals to get a strong foundation. Moreover, different tools and machines are used in the excavation process, preparing the site for further development.

1- Topsoil excavation 

This form of excavation is classified based on the type of material used. The topsoil process of excavation involves the removal of the highest area or exposed layer of the earth’s surface.  

The removal may include vegetation, dead and decaying matter, or any unwanted particles from the soil. The important thing about this excavation is it makes the earth highly compressible and can vary from place to place in depth.  

In most cases, the depth ranges from 150 to 300 mm. Hence, it consists of the uppermost area, making the soil unsuitable for structural loads.

3- Trench excavation 

Based on the purpose of the work, trench excavation is involved in the formation of pipelines, sewage systems, and strip foundations. It is generally considered a length and in-depth form of a hole with a depth greater than 6m.  

For installing shallow trenches, this form of excavation is used. Like other excavation services, this one also requires some equipment and tools for efficient working. However, the type of equipment used depends on the following factors: 

  • The purpose of the trench 
  • The ground conditions of that area 
  • Location of the trench 
  • Number of barriers in that place 
    Hence, according to these factors, the excavation process proceeds further, and the backfilling is done on the construction site.
